guinea-hen_flower
1. [ noun ] (botany) Eurasian checkered lily with pendant flowers usually veined and checkered with purple or maroon on a pale ground and shaped like the bells carried by lepers in medieval times; widely grown as an ornamental
Synonyms: checkered_daffodil leper_lily Fritillaria_meleagris snake's_head_fritillary
